Toning Brassy Hair

If you have hard water like I do then you might know it’s effect on your hair. Not only does it leave build up on your scalp and dry your hair out, it can also turn your colored hair a brassy orange shade. I have tried many different techniques to remove brassiness such as clarifying treatments, water filters, ash hair color, and blue shampoo but I was not getting the results that I wanted. After some research I found several videos that praised  Wella Toners for brassy hair.

 

The Formula is quite simple.

One part Wella Toner T-18

Two Parts Developer

 

Directions-

1.Shampoo your hair and towel dry it until it is damp.

2. Dress in a shirt that you do not mind stains on and have a towel ready for spills (also preferably one you do not mind stains on).

3. Put on gloves then mix together the one part toner and two parts developer.

4. I use a brush to apply the color but since you have gloves you can use your hands as well.

5. Leave it on for around 30 minutes and then wash out with shampoo and conditioner.
